“Storing an abundance of hazardous materials at facilities can present a threat to the public, environment and the surrounding area. Discharge of these perilous substances into the soil may lead to costly decontamination procedures. The influence of weather on the external surfaces and the internal temperature variations of the tank are the two major reasons behind the leakage of storage tanks that contain oil, gas or chemicals. The above-mentioned types of dangerous situations can cause devastating injuries and loss.
